A watercolor on paper of a Colorado rural scene by Harold E. Keeler, dated 1938, signed lower right, 10 1/4 x 14 in. sight, 16 1/2 x 20 in. matted, condition very good. Harold Emerson Keeler (CO, WA, 1905-1968) Keeler was a native of Denver, Colorado. From 1928 to 1931 he studied at the University of Colorado and the Chicago Art Institute. Following his studies in Chicago, he moved to Denver where he worked for the Denver Art Museum where he designed and painted backdrops to exhibits; he also worked as a freelance lithographer. Keeler relocated to Seattle, WA in the 1940’s where he worked as an artist/lithographer for the Boeing Corporation. He is noted for his watercolors and lithographs.
